About

The Quadsat QS 6-24 DL extends the drone-based RF antenna measurement concept into higher frequencies, supporting C, Ku, and Ka-band ground station antennas. Operating from 6 to 24 GHz, the system uses a UAV carrying calibrated RF reference antennas to fly prescribed far-field trajectories around the antenna under test.

The measurement campaign produces complete radiation patterns including gain, sidelobe, and cross-polarization without needing an antenna range or halting satellite operations. Post-processing software compares measured patterns to antenna manufacturer specifications, flagging deviations or degradation. This system is particularly valuable for rapid verification of newly installed dishes and for diagnosing pattern asymmetry and blockage effects in operational environments.
